CGW4U Canadian and World Issues: A
Geographic Analysis, Grade 12, University
This
course draws on geographic concepts, skills,
methods, and technologies to analyse significant
issues facing Canadians as citizens of an
interdependent world. Students will
examine the challenges of creating a sustainable
and equitable future through the study of
a range of topics, including economic interdependence,
geopolitical conflict, regional disparities
in the ability to meet basic human needs.
Prerequisite:
Any University, University/College in Social
Sciences, or English or Canadian or world
studies.
